Our client is seeking a skilled Senior .NET Developer to join their R&D team. In this role, you will design, develop, and maintain complex web applications and services, drive technical decisions, and ensure high-quality, scalable software solutions. As a senior developer, you’ll mentor junior staff and lead projects in an agile environment.
Key Requirements
- 5+ years of experience in .NET development, with expertise in C#, .NET Core, ASP.NET MVC, Entity Framework, Razor/Blazor.
- Strong experience with Redis, RabbitMQ, background services (e.g., Hangfire, [URL Removed] and AWS.
- Expertise with PostgreSQL and AWS cloud services (e.g., Amazon RDS, Lambda, S3, EC2, CloudFormation).
- Proficiency with microservices architecture, RESTful APIs, Docker, and Kubernetes.
- Experience with CI/CD pipelines and infrastructure automation (e.g., Terraform, ARM templates).
- Strong SQL skills with T-SQL and PostgreSQL database optimization.
- Familiarity with unit testing frameworks (e.g., xUnit, NUnit), DevOps tools, and Agile/Scrum methodologies
Should you meet the requirements for this position, please email your CV to [Email Address Removed]. You can also contact the IT team on [Phone Number Removed]; or visit our website at [URL Removed] NOTE: When replying to the advert, also include the reference number in the subject line. Correspondence will only be conducted with short listed candidates. Should you not hear from us within 3 days, please consider your application unsuccessful.
Desired Skills:
- .NET
- AWS
- SQL
- C#
- Blazor